## Deploying the Gatewick Proctor Queue

Deploys are pretty painless: push to main, wait for the pipeline, then watch the queue drain dashboard for five minutes. If candidates pile up mid-exam, roll back first and ask questions later — the queue replays safely. Everything the workers care about lives in one config block, shown here for reference.

settings of bafof-yagef:
JOROX_PIN=8740
JOROX_TENANT=pelox
JOROX_METRICS_HOST=metrics.jorox.qorvelworks.internal
JOROX_SEAL=seal_c78f63c1
JOROX_STANDBY_TEAM=norax

## Runbook: Gaugepile Sidecar — Release Checklist

Heads up: the sidecar ships with every app pod, so a bad config fans out fast. Before cutting a release, confirm the flush interval hasn't drifted from what the Tallyhouse aggregator expects, or you'll see sawtooth gaps in dashboards. Rollbacks are cheap — just repin the image tag. Canary one node pool first, watch for ten minutes, then proceed. The values to verify against are these.

config for bagep-yafof:
quenath:
  pin: 8584
  metrics_host: metrics.quenath.tolvaqsys.internal
  tenant: pelath
  seal: seal_ed102645

Ticket: Config drift on CSV import wizard (Fieldhopper). Welcome aboard — quick context: the staging instance of the Fieldhopper import wizard has drifted from what's in the repo. Someone hand-edited delimiter detection and row-limit settings directly on the box back in March, and redeploys keep reverting behavior testers rely on. Please reconcile staging against the values below and commit the result. Here are the current live values pulled from staging.

config for tajof-tajef:
ralael:
  pin: 3468
  metrics_host: metrics.ralael.lumicsys.internal
  tenant: casath
  seal: seal_c325d9c6

Leadership Review Briefing — Regional Expansion

Tornvale Foods will open its first branches in the Eastmere region next spring. Two sites are leased; a third is under negotiation. Staffing will draw on transfers from the Ralden cluster plus local hiring. Branch managers should expect revised logistics routes by February. Full financial projections and timing considerations appear in the confidential note below.

management briefing: Istaelix Group is in early talks to buy Sorysax Logistics for about $496.2 million. The Kasox launch date is October 3, and nothing goes to the press before then. Legal wants the Norokax Foods term sheet withdrawn before April 25.